TOMS RIVER, NJ - The Northampton women's basketball team snapped their 2-game losing streak, downing Ocean County College 85-53 on Thursday evening at the Viking Center.
The Spartans got off to a quick start, taking a 19-10 lead after the 1st quarter and expanding that lead to 34-19 at the halftime break.
Heaven Dubois (Lancaster, PA/JP McCaskey) recorded a huge double-double with 23 points and 14 rebounds, while
Kailen Felty (Pine Grove, PA/Pine Grove) added 22 points and 7 rebounds and
Layla Sweatte (Allentown, PA/William Allen) finished with 18 points.
"Great team win tonight," stated Head Coach
Carly Gallagher, "we definitely needed this win today after a tough stretch last week. Hopefully we are back on track and ready to make a playoff push."
Racquel Costache added 14 rebounds for the Spartans.
The win moves Northampton to 12-6 overall and 9-4 in Region 19.
Ocean falls to 5-12 overall and 4-10 in the Region.
The Spartans are now off until Tuesday January 28th when they host the Jersey Blues of Brookdale.
